I think that it is an authentic tanto tsuba, but the photograph needs better white balancing.  The photograph has shifted the colors in a way so that they look a bit unnatural, giving it an "overcleaned" look.  My guess is that it would probably look better in person.

What I am seeing when magnified are areas of loss of the silver plating from the copper base which appears pinkish in the picture(s).  It would of course be better to evaluate in hand.
